Tranquility and convenience in Pinebrook
Pinebrook is a New Rochelle community known for its lush greenery, proximity to parks and central location. “In Pinebrook, you get the feel of Scarsdale, which is probably the most expensive ZIP code in Westchester,” says Yin Chen, a real estate salesperson with R2M Realty who’s sold homes in the area since 2014, “but you’re not paying the taxes of Scarsdale, which could be a difference of $10,000 to $15,000 a year.” Despite its peaceful setting, Pinebrook is within 4 miles of downtown New Rochelle, Eastchester and Larchmont, providing convenient access to popular commercial areas and public transportation to New York City, located about 23 miles away.
A tree-filled neighborhood with split-level and new traditional homes
“Within the neighborhood itself, it’s very tranquil, with a lot of mature trees and vegetation,” Chen says. Midcentury split-level homes line Pinebrook’s tree-shaded streets and typically feature attached garages, paved driveways and manicured lawns. Prices typically range from around $750,000 to $1.4 million, depending on size and renovations. In the gated Cherry Lawn subdivision, 21st-century colonial-style new traditional homes can cost between $1.8 million and $2.5 million, plus monthly homeowners association fees of around $1,300. Townhouses, some in gated communities, can cost between $800,000 and $1.8 million, depending on size, plus monthly HOA fees between $600 and $750.

Highly rated New Rochelle public schools and private schools
Kids can attend William B. Ward Elementary, which earns a B-plus from Niche, and then go to the A-minus-rated Albert Leonard Middle. Students at the A-minus-rated New Rochelle High can receive the New York State Seal of Biliteracy on their diplomas by demonstrating proficiency in a language other than English. Nearby private options include the A-plus-rated Iona Preparatory School, an all-boys school for kindergarten through Grade 12, and the A-rated Westchester Torah Academy for pre-kindergarten through Grade 8.

Public parks and private golf clubs offer ways to get outside
Pinebrook Park has a playground and basketball courts in the neighborhood. The over 60-acre Ward Acres Park is nearby, featuring forested walking paths and Paws Place, the largest dog park in Westchester. Gardeners can rent plots at the Ward Acres Community Garden. Several private golf courses are nearby, including the Winged Foot Golf Club, which has two 18-hole courses and is designated a National Historic Landmark.

Near restaurants and stores in Larchmont, Mamaroneck and Eastchester
Pinebrook is within 3 miles of the walkable commercial districts in Larchmont and Mamaroneck, which have a variety of locally owned shops and restaurants. In Larchmont, Lusardi’s has served upscale Italian cuisine with a large wine selection since 1995. Mamaroneck is home to restaurants like Red Plum, which serves hibachi and sushi in a modern atmosphere. Eastchester is also close, where shoppers can browse national retailers like West Elm and Jos A. Bank. Nearby grocery stores include Cherry Lawn Farm, DeCicco & Sons and Trader Joe’s.

Car, train and bus routes connect to New York City and Westchester
Pinebrook Avenue leads about 4 miles to downtown New Rochelle. The Hutchinson River Parkway leads about 23 miles to New York City, and Interstate 95 is nearby. The Larchmont train station is 3 miles away and has routes to Grand Central Station, a commute that takes roughly 45 minutes. The Bee-Line bus system has routes throughout Westchester County. Montefiore New Rochelle Hospital is 4 miles away. The Westchester County Airport offers domestic flights 11 miles away, and John F. Kennedy International Airport is a 25-mile trip.
Summer camp and social events at Temple Israel of New Rochelle
Temple Israel of New Rochelle has served the community since 1908. In addition to regular social events and pickleball clinics, it hosts Camp Pinebrook each summer, a day camp where kids can play sports, swim and do creative activities like art and dance.
Flooding risk near Pinebrook Boulevard
Homes near Pinebrook Boulevard are in a Special Flood Hazard Area and are at high risk of flooding. Homeowners here might have to buy flood insurance and get special permits for construction projects.

Pinebrook Demographics and Home Trends
On average, homes in Pinebrook, New Rochelle sell after 30 days on the market compared to the national average of 55 days. The median sale price for homes in Pinebrook, New Rochelle over the last 12 months is $1,300,000, up 28% from the median home sale price over the previous 12 months.
